Charwan is a Rural village located in Machhor, Almora,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Charwan is 91.
Charwan village comprises 23 households.
The literacy rate in Charwan is 80.8%. Among the literate population of 63, there are 28 literate males and 35 literate females.
In Charwan, there are 36 males and 55 females, with a sex ratio of 1528 females per 1000 males.
There are 13 children (14.3% of population), comprising 6 boys and 7 girls.
The total number of workers in Charwan is 39, with 39 main workers and 0 marginal workers.
In Charwan, there are 1 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 1 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Charwan is located in Uttarakhand state, Almora district, and falls under Machhor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 52244 and LGD code is 52244.
